欢迎您访问:澳门威斯尼斯人官网网站!1.2 示波器的工作原理:示波器的工作原理基于示波管的电子束偏转和屏幕上的荧光点显示。当待测信号输入示波器时,经过放大和处理后,示波器会将信号转换成电子束的偏转电压,使电子束在屏幕上绘制出相应的波形图。
使用NodeMCU构建低成本wifi中继器(使用NodeMCU打造低成本WiFi中继器)
随着智能设备的普及,对于无线网络的需求也越来越大。由于一些特殊原因,家庭中的无线网络信号可能无法覆盖到每个角落。为了解决这个问题,我们可以使用NodeMCU来构建一个低成本的WiFi中继器,以扩大无线网络的覆盖范围。本文将详细介绍如何使用NodeMCU构建低成本wifi中继器,并为读者提供背景信息。
NodeMCU是一款基于ESP8266芯片的开源物联网平台,它具有WiFi模块和微控制器的功能。NodeMCU支持Lua脚本语言,并且可以通过USB接口进行编程和调试。由于其简单易用和低成本的特点,NodeMCU成为了很多物联网项目的首选平台。
WiFi中继器是一种设备,可以接收来自路由器的WiFi信号,并将其转发到其他设备。它可以通过放置在信号覆盖范围外的位置,将无线网络信号扩展到更远的地方。中继器通过接收和转发信号的方式,实现了无线网络的延伸。
使用NodeMCU构建WiFi中继器具有以下几个优势:
1)低成本:NodeMCU的价格相对较低,相比其他商用的WiFi中继器,使用NodeMCU可以节省不少费用。
2)灵活性:NodeMCU可以通过编程进行定制,可以根据实际需求进行功能扩展和定制化开发。
3)易用性:NodeMCU的编程语言Lua相对简单易懂,即使是对于非专业人士来说,也可以快速上手。
在开始构建WiFi中继器之前,我们需要准备以下材料:
1)NodeMCU开发板
2)USB数据线
3)电脑
4)路由器
将NodeMCU开发板通过USB数据线连接到电脑上。然后,将路由器的网线连接到NodeMCU的WAN口上。接下来,将NodeMCU的LAN口连接到需要扩展WiFi信号的设备上。
我们需要下载并安装NodeMCU的开发环境。然后,通过USB数据线将NodeMCU连接到电脑上,并打开开发环境。在开发环境中,我们可以使用Lua语言编写代码,并将其上传到NodeMCU中。
在开发环境中,澳门威斯尼斯人官网我们可以编写代码来实现WiFi中继器的功能。我们需要配置NodeMCU的WiFi连接信息,包括路由器的SSID和密码。然后,我们可以使用NodeMCU的WiFi模块来扫描周围的WiFi信号,并选择一个信号进行中继。
编写完代码后,我们可以将其上传到NodeMCU中。在开发环境中,选择对应的端口和开发板类型,并点击上传按钮。上传完成后,NodeMCU将自动重启,并开始执行我们编写的代码。
在NodeMCU重启后,我们可以通过连接到中继器的设备来测试WiFi信号的强度和稳定性。如果一切正常,我们就成功地使用NodeMCU构建了一个低成本的WiFi中继器。
在使用NodeMCU构建WiFi中继器时,需要注意以下几点:
1)确保NodeMCU和路由器之间的距离适中,以保证信号的稳定性。
2)在编写代码时,要注意避免与其他WiFi信号发生干扰,可以选择一个较少使用的信道。
3)定期检查NodeMCU的固件是否有更新,并及时进行升级,以确保系统的稳定性和安全性。
使用NodeMCU构建的低成本WiFi中继器可以应用于以下场景:
1)家庭网络扩展:将WiFi中继器放置在家中信号覆盖不到的地方,可以扩大无线网络的覆盖范围,方便家庭成员在各个房间使用无线网络。
2)办公室网络扩展:在办公室中,WiFi信号常常会因为墙壁和障碍物的阻挡而变弱,使用WiFi中继器可以解决这个问题,提供更好的无线网络覆盖。
使用NodeMCU构建低成本WiFi中继器可以帮助我们解决无线网络覆盖不到的地方的问题。通过简单的硬件连接和软件设置,我们可以快速搭建一个功能强大的WiFi中继器。NodeMCU的低成本、灵活性和易用性使得它成为构建低成本WiFi中继器的理想选择。希望本文对读者能够有所帮助,欢迎大家尝试使用NodeMCU构建自己的WiFi中继器。